A new chapter in robotic agility has been written on the Chinese mainland. A Beijing-based team has unveiled N2, a 1.3-meter-tall humanoid robot capable of performing continuous backflips, marking a major milestone in the booming humanoid robot industry.
Innovative hardware designs ensure N2's stability during dynamic maneuvers, intriguing tech enthusiasts, sports fans, and young changemakers alike.
